Here's his digits, 6'3" 220lbs, went from 1 TD 2014 to 8 in his final year.

40 Yrd Dash: 4.49
20 Yrd Dash: 2.64
10 Yrd Dash: 1.59
225 Lb. Bench Reps: 17
Vertical Jump: 34 1/2
Broad Jump: 10'00"
20 Yrd Shuttle: 4.29
3-Cone Drill: 6.94

Darius Powe*|*California,*WR*:*2016 NFL Draft Scout Player Profile

Colston 6'4" 225lbs and here's his particulars:

40 Yrd Dash: 4.54
20 Yrd Dash: 2.66
10 Yrd Dash: 1.59 225 Lb. Bench Reps: 16
Vertical Jump: 37
Broad Jump: 10'03"
20 Yrd Shuttle: 4.43
3-Cone Drill: 6.94

Marques Colston*|*Hofstra,*WR*:*2006 NFL Draft Scout Player Profile

LOOKS LIKE A REPLACEMENT TO ME!
